While stock prices fluctuate daily, successful long-term investors focus on understanding the actual value of a business. Fundamental Analysis helps investors determine whether a stock is undervalued, fairly valued, or overvalued by analyzing financial statements, industry dynamics, management quality, business models, and future growth potential.
